Title
An explicit criterion for the positional relationship of an ellipse and a parabola

Abstract
In many fields such as computer animation, computer graphics, machine vision, robotics, virtual reality and CAD/CAM, it is a common problem to detect the positional relationship between two planar conics. Based on the generalized characteristic polynomial and the affine invariants of two conics, explicit conditions are derived for classifying the various positional relationships between an ellipse and a parabola, namely, separation, exterior tangency, intersection, interior tangency and inclusion. The explicit conditions can be expressed in terms of the coefficients of the quadratic forms representing the ellipse and the parabola.
